2008 Hummer H3 vs. 1953 Nissan Sports
To start off, 2008 Hummer H3 is newer by 55 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1953 Nissan Sports.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1953 Nissan Sports would be higher. At 3,700 cc (5 cylinders), 2008 Hummer H3 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2008 Hummer H3 (242 HP @ 5600 RPM) has 224 more horse power than 1953 Nissan Sports. (18 HP @ 3600 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2008 Hummer H3 should accelerate faster than 1953 Nissan Sports.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Hummer H3 weights approximately 1481 kg more than 1953 Nissan Sports.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 2008 Hummer H3 (328 Nm @ 4600 RPM) has 279 more torque (in Nm) than 1953 Nissan Sports. (49 Nm @ 2000 RPM). This means 2008 Hummer H3 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1953 Nissan Sports.
